The investment size accounts for 65 percent of the global investment planned during the same period, LG said.
The plan was announced at LG's 62nd shareholders' meeting on Wednesday.
"The global management environment in 2024 will have more uncertainties as a number of inflection points reside related to the generalization of AI, decarbonization, and so on," said LG Chairman Koo Kwang-mo.
"While closely monitoring the industries around our core businesses, we will bolster future businesses like AI, bio and cleantech so they can grow into main pillars of our future business portfolio."
LG said 55 percent of the announced investment will be dedicated to research and development (R&D) and smart factories, vying to turn Korea into a manufacturing hub
